JoAnn Rainboldt was relaxing in her home in Anchorage, Alaska when she spotted a curious lynx exploring her deck, unaware that it was being observed. Lynx are very shy animals, so catching a glimpse of one, much less a video, is a sight to behold.
Lynx are generally even-tempered, shy animals, and it’s always wise to admire them from afar—or from behind a wall as Rainboldt did.
You’ll notice that lynx have very large paws in proportion to the rest of their body. These are meant to keep them from sinking into snow as they hunt their favourite prey, the elusive snowshoe hare.
